Furniture & Decor Designed by SARAH SHERMAN SAMUEL
To get familiar with the work of designer Sarah Sherman Samuel, peek inside her world in this Magnolia Network series I have watched and re-watched:
How would you describe her warm, modern, natural, California-inspired whimsical designs?

There’s a playfulness for sure, and as an artist, she comes up with innovative ideas and shapes for any number of things that feel otherworldly. (Have you seen a range hood shaped like the one above anywhere before?)

While her focus is bespoke design in most cases, fortunately she also offers furniture and decor through Lulu & Georgia.

What’s helpful is how you need not have a huge budget…there are objects designed by Sarah you can pick up for under $30.

I love how she mixes dramatic natural marble with understated cabinetry and modern art pieces, and it all feels luxurious but very livable.

Playful & Whimsical Design from Lulu & Georgia
There’s something very playful and youthful about how she plays with geometrics and throws a curve into nearly every design.

Isn’t that ripple chair imaginative?

I’m also a fan of how Sarah takes an unfussy approach to furniture design and lifestyle.

It’s a very spare look, but not a sterile cold one.

If you love a repetition of squares, I bet you’ll see that common thread too along with squiggles and wiggly shapes.
The overall look refuses to take itself overly serious, but it is seriously sumptuous and comfy!
Notice how that sofa cushion on the end is hugging the curved line of the base.

She has so much fun playing with scale, and I’m not sure I have ever seen a skinny long bolster pillow quite like this one above.
There are plenty of MCM references, and I can imagine how well Sarah Sherman Samuel designed pieces work with vintage Midcentury ones.
